#9783f2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9783f2 is composed of 59.2% red, 51.4%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37.6% cyan, 45.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 250.8 degrees, a saturation of 81% and a lightness of 73.1%. #9783f2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#2f07e5. Closest websafe color is: #9999ff.

#9783f2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9783f2 has RGB values of R:151, G:131, B:242 and CMYK values of C:0.38, M:0.46,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 9929714.

Shades and Tints of #9783f2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f0eef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#9783f2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b9b8bd is the less saturated color, while #9078fd is the most saturated one.
